Fabricated heat insulation plate for building
The invention relates to the field of building boards, in particular to a heat insulation board for a fabricated building. The assembly type heat insulation plate for the building comprises a power storage unit, a piston plate and a trigger device, under the change of the external temperature, gas in an inner cavity of a detection rod is subjected to heat expansion and cold contraction under the influence of the temperature, the length of the detection rod is changed, and when the detection rod is stretched or shortened, a power storage piece is made to store power through a transmission unit. After long-time use, a small amount of air enters the first cavity in the plate body, the vacuum degree in the first cavity is reduced, the air entering the first cavity expands with heat and contracts with cold according to the change of the external temperature, the detection block is pushed to slide in the first cavity, force storage on the force storage part is relieved through the unlocking rod, and meanwhile the force storage part releases force; when the force storage part releases force, the piston plate slides in the second cavity, gas in the first cavity is gradually extracted, the vacuum degree in the first cavity is kept, and the heat insulation effect of the plate body is improved.
